One popular water cycle craft involves creating a mobile that showcases the various stages of the water cycle. Children can color and cut out the different elements, such as the sun, clouds, and water droplets, before attaching them to a string or hanger. As they assemble the mobile, they can learn about how water moves through the atmosphere and the earth, providing a hands-on experience that reinforces classroom learning.

Another option for a water cycle craft is to create a flipbook that illustrates the progression of water from evaporation to precipitation. By flipping through the pages, children can see how water transforms from a gas to a liquid and back again, helping to solidify their understanding of this scientific concept. This interactive craft allows children to actively engage with the material and reinforce their knowledge in a creative way.

For those looking for a more advanced craft activity, a 3D water cycle diorama can be a challenging yet rewarding project. By using the free printable templates as a guide, children can construct a three-dimensional scene that showcases the different components of the water cycle. This hands-on craft requires cutting, folding, and gluing, providing a tactile experience that can enhance learning and retention.
